Where does the verb gonna come from? Earliest known use. 1800s. The earliest known use of the verb gonna is in the 1800s. OED's earliest evidence for gonna is from 1806, in the writing of A. Douglas. gonna is a variant or alteration of another lexical item. Etymons: English going to. Tump, tump, tump, tump, back it up-tup ( Hm, haibo) You know I love to make it. "I ...Informal Contractions. Informal contractions are short forms of other words that people use when speaking casually. They are not exactly slang, but they are a little like slang. For example, "gonna" is a short form of "going to". If you say going to very fast, without carefully pronouncing each word, it can sound like gonna.

Please remember that these are informal contractions. That means that we do not use them in "correct" speech, and we almost never use them in writing.Gonna, gotta and wanna are not contractions. Contractions are shortenings like aren’t and can’t. The missing letters have been replaced by an apostrophe, and the original words are discernible in the contraction. Contractions are acceptable in all but the most formal writing. Let's find out! Advertisement Advertisemen...Don’t use “gonna” and “wanna” in formal writing. “Gonna” comes from “going to” and “wanna” comes from “want to”. Actually, these words are two-times removed from the original phrases. “Going to” –> “Goin’ t'” –> “Gonna” and “Want to” –> “Want t'” –> “Wanna”.
